History of Woodworking in Gary, Indiana
The history of woodworking in Gary, Indiana, is as rich and diverse as the city itself. Founded in 1906 as a steel town, Gary quickly attracted a melting pot of cultures and trades. Among these was woodworking, which flourished alongside the industrial boom.
Early craftsmen utilized the abundant local timber to create furniture and structures that reflected both practicality and artistry. As you explore this history, you will uncover stories of skilled artisans who laid the groundwork for future generations. Throughout the decades, woodworking in Gary has evolved significantly.
The decline of the steel industry in the late 20th century led to a resurgence of interest in traditional crafts, including woodworking. Local artisans began to reclaim their heritage by teaching others the skills they had mastered. This revival not only preserved the craft but also fostered a renewed sense of pride within the community.
Today, woodworking stands as a testament to Gary’s resilience and creativity, with many workshops and classes dedicated to keeping this tradition alive.

Tools and Equipment Used in Woodworking

To embark on your woodworking journey, familiarizing yourself with the tools and equipment is essential. In Gary’s workshops, you will encounter a variety of hand tools and power tools designed for different tasks. Hand tools such as chisels, hand saws, and planes allow for precision work and fine detailing, while power tools like table saws and routers can significantly speed up the process for larger projects.
Understanding how to use these tools safely and effectively is crucial for any woodworker. Many classes emphasize tool safety and maintenance, ensuring that you develop good habits from the start. As you gain confidence in using these tools, you will find that they become extensions of your creativity, enabling you to bring your ideas to fruition with greater ease.
Safety Measures in Woodworking
Safety is paramount in woodworking, especially when working with sharp tools and heavy machinery. In Gary’s woodworking classes, instructors prioritize safety training as part of the curriculum. You will learn essential practices such as wearing app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E), including safety glasses and ear protection, to safeguard against potential hazards.
Additionally, understanding how to properly handle tools is vital for preventing accidents. You will be taught about safe operating procedures for each piece of equipment and how to maintain a clean workspace to minimize risks. By instilling these safety measures early on, instructors help ensure that your woodworking experience is both enjoyable and secure.
Tips for Choosing the Right Woodworking Class
When selecting a woodworking class in Gary, consider your skill level and specific interests. If you’re just starting out, look for beginner-friendly courses that focus on foundational skills such as measuring, cutting, and joining wood. These classes often provide a supportive environment where you can learn at your own pace.
Additionally, think about what type of projects excite you most. Some classes may specialize in furniture making while others focus on smaller crafts or decorative items. Researching instructors’ backgrounds can also provide insight into their teaching styles and expertise.
Ultimately, choosing the right class will enhance your learning experience and help you achieve your woodworking goals.
